Output 778e613f7e2124cc05cd3dbae27fa7d7bae841a9cbcd6b58bc5f09bfa88fde73:0

value
99004355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3071e8e34bb641c667847f8d5538bb5fa89aea OP_EQUAL
address
3Qmkv6GdWLqZtFFYTjwwLvaBen84PaUwDY
transaction
778e613f7e2124cc05cd3dbae27fa7d7bae841a9cbcd6b58bc5f09bfa88fde73
confirmations
1628
spent
true